What is Oursync?

Oursync is one shared calendar for two people. You propose a plan, and it books only into time that's free for both of you — so you never double-book, and you never have to reveal your private schedule to each other.

How does the privacy part work?

Oursync only works with your busy and free time slots. It never reads or stores your event titles, locations, notes, or guests. When your partner proposes a plan, they only learn whether a time works — never what you're busy with.

Do I need a partner to use it?

No. You can start using Oursync on your own and invite your partner whenever you're ready. The app works fine for one person and unlocks shared planning once someone accepts your invitation.

How do I connect with my partner?

Open the Partner tab and send your partner an invite link. When they accept, the two of you share one calendar (a “circle”) and can start proposing plans together.

What do the plan statuses mean?

A plan that's free for both books immediately as “awaiting confirmation.” Your partner can then confirm or decline it. You'll also see “confirmed,” “declined,” and “cancelled” states so you always know where a plan stands.
